Number of Awards & Eligibility: Two scholarships are awarded.
In order to qualify, students must meet the following criteria:
  1. Must be a U.S. or Canadian Citizen, or legal resident of the U.S. or Canada.
  2. Must be pursuing a Technical/Vocational, Associates or Bachelor’s degree.
  3. Must be currently enrolled, or accepted to an accredited school, college or university by April 15, 2020
  4. Msut be female.
  5. Msut be at least 30 years of age as of January 1, 2020.
  6. Must exhibit a need for financial assistance.

Additional Information: The “Women on Par” Scholarship Program, provided by the LPGA Foundation, was established in 2007 by the EWGA Foundation (now the LPGA Amateur Golf AssociationTM) to provide financial assistance to “non-traditional” female students. These scholarships are intended for women, aged 30 and older, who are attending a college or university for the first time or returning to school after an absence to complete their technical/vocational, Associate, or Bachelor’s degree. The scholarships are designed to help these women get “on par,” or get an equal footing, with their peers, friends, and other women who have had a chance to complete their college education.
